The Gifts of the Holy Spirit
“The Spirit of the Lord comes upon him: the spirit of wisdom and discernment, the spirit of counsel and strength, the spirit of knowledge and the fear of the Lord.” This is a paraphrase of how the prophet Isaiah describes the working of the Spirit of God, who rests upon the Messiah. The New Testament recognizes a multiplicity of further gifts of the Spirit (charisms): character gifts such as mercy and martyrdom, practical gifts such as wise counsel and leadership, and of course more dramatic gifts such as prophecy and healing. This course will center more on these latter gifts.

Course Goals
- The student describes the foundations of spiritual gifts in biblical faith.
- The student articulates ways in which different spiritual gifts work together.
- The student expresses understanding for healing in its biblical context.
- The student demonstrates discernment between divine healing and healing phenomena in esoteric thought and circles.
- The student describes identifiers of prophetic speech.
- The student summarizes the significance of prophecy and healing in the ministry of evangelism.
- The student demonstrates a healthy and practice-oriented understanding of the use of spiritual gifts in the church.
Acquired Skills
- Praying appropriately for people suffering from illness.
- Demonstrating pastoral counseling competencies in the care of sick people.
- Testing and discerning the validity of prophetic utterances.
- Applying prophetic speech for the edification, warning, and comfort of others.
